Abstract
145,530. Tondeur, R. April 29, 1918, [Convention date]. Spray carburettors.-In a device for supplying light and heavy fuels to a carburettor, the fuels are delivered through calibrated ducts into a common feed chamber, the lighter fuel being supplied at a pressure higher than that of the heavier fuel and discharged through a duct of smaller section than the heavier fuel. Light fuel is supplied through an inlet 8 to a chamber 9 open to atmosphere at 10, and is then discharged through a calibrated orifice 11 leading to a chamber 6<1> whence it flows through a passage 7 to the nozzle or float chamber Heavier fuel is admitted at 4 past a calibrated orifice 6 to the common chamber 6'. The level in the light-fuel float chamber is higher than that in the heavy fuel chamber so that the light fuel forces back the heavy into conduit 4 and thus light fuel is supplied at starting. As the engine speed increases, the orifice 11 is unable to supply the whole of the fuel necessary, and the heavier fuel comes into use. The dimensions of the calibrated orifices and the pressures of the fuels can be made such that heavy fuel alone is supplied at the normal engine speed. The Specification as open to inspection under Sect. 91 (3) (a) describes also the carburettor shown in Fig. 1 (Cancelled). The control valve 1 is placed between the air inlet 2 and the main nozzle 4. The main chamber 5, auxiliary chamber 6 and the space 7 above the fuel in the float chamber are in communication through apertures 8, 9. With the valve 1 closed, air is drawn through a tube 10 in the main nozzle to provide a starting mixture. The float 12 surrounds a tube 13 enclosing a cross-shaped red 14 carrying at its upper end conical balanced valves 16, 17 working in conjunction with seats 18, 19. The rod is actuated by a cross-pin 15 on the float. Fuel enters at 20 and flows past valve 17 and rod 14 and also past valve 16 and through spaces 22, 23 to the float chamber. In a modification, two separate valves are employed, that actuated by the float having its seat in a larger and separate valve. This subject-matter does not appear in the Specification as accepted.
